  • the Dynamic Host Configuration Protocol (DHCP) packet can be sent to the DHCP server in two ways. One is local forwarding and the other is centralized forwarding. . In the local forwarding, the DHCP message sent by the user equipment is directly forwarded to the DHCP server by the access point (abbreviation: AP). In the centralized forwarding, the DHCP message sent by the user equipment is sent by the wireless AP. The controller (English: controller) is then forwarded by the controller to the DHCP server.
  • AP access point
  • controller International: controller
  • the DHCP server After the user equipment is authenticated, the DHCP server allocates an Internet Protocol (IP) address to the user equipment and determines the lease duration (English: lease duration).
  • IP Internet Protocol
  • the IP address can only be used by the user equipment before the lease expires. That is, the user equipment cannot use the IP address before the lease expires, regardless of whether the user equipment uses the IP address. Since the number of IP addresses that can be assigned by the DHCP server is limited, when the IP address on the DHCP server is allocated, if a new user device is online, the user device will not get an IP address and cannot access the network, but some have already The IP address assigned to the user equipment is not actually used, but the lease of the IP address has not arrived yet, resulting in waste of IP address resources.

  • the DHCP release packet may pass through other devices during the process of sending the DHCP release packet to the DHCP server. If DHCP snooping is used on these devices, DHCP snooping monitors whether the port that sends the DHCP release packet is the same as the port in the DHCP snooping table. If the packets are inconsistent, the packet is invalid. Message. Therefore, in order to make the forwarding path of the DHCP release packet consistent with the path of the DHCP packet in the IP address allocation process, the AP needs to determine whether the AP is the authentication AP of the user equipment after receiving the offline message sent by the user equipment.
